Identifying Common Problems
Low Air Pressure: Low air pressure is a common issue that can arise due to various factors. It can be caused by a worn-out pump, loose fittings, or a blocked air filter.
Noise and Vibration: Excessive noise and vibration can signal underlying problems within the air compressor. These symptoms may be indicative of a failing motor, loose components, or a misaligned pump.
Oil Leaks: Oil leaks are a significant concern as they can lead to equipment failure. Causes of oil leaks may include worn-out seals, cracked reservoirs, or a faulty oil drain valve.
Failure to Start: If your air compressor fails to start, it could be due to a faulty relay, a dead battery, or a tripped circuit breaker.
High Energy Consumption: Increased energy consumption might be a sign of a failing motor or inefficient operation, which can lead to higher operational costs and shorter lifespan of the compressor.
Diagnosing the Root Cause
Check the Air Filter: A clogged air filter can lead to low air pressure and reduced efficiency. Replace the air filter if it is dirty or damaged.
Inspect the Oil Level: Ensure that the oil level is within the recommended range. Low oil levels can cause premature wear and tear on the pump and other components.

Check the Fittings: Inspect all fittings for tightness and replace any worn-out or damaged parts.
Test the Motor: Use a multimeter to test the motor for continuity and ensure it is functioning properly.
Fixing a Malfunctioning Air Compressor
- Low Air Pressure:
- Replace the air filter if it is clogged or damaged.
- Check the pump for leaks and replace any worn-out seals.
Inspect the pressure relief valve for proper operation and replace if necessary.
Noise and Vibration:
- Tighten loose components and replace any worn-out parts.
- Check the motor for signs of failure and replace if necessary.
Ensure that the pump is properly aligned with the motor.
Oil Leaks:
- Replace worn-out seals and gaskets.
- Inspect the reservoir for cracks and replace if necessary.
Check the oil drain valve for proper operation and replace if necessary.
Failure to Start:
- Test the relay and replace if it is faulty.
- Check the battery for low voltage and recharge or replace if necessary.
Ensure that the circuit breaker is not tripped.
High Energy Consumption:
- Replace the motor if it is failing.
- Insulate the compressor to reduce heat loss.
- Perform regular maintenance to ensure efficient operation.

Low Air Pressure: A Comprehensive Approach
Low air pressure is a common issue that can significantly impact the performance of your air compressor. To address this problem effectively, it's crucial to follow a systematic approach:
Visual Inspection: Begin by visually inspecting the compressor for any visible signs of damage or wear. Look for cracks in the tank, loose fittings, or any obvious signs of leakage.
Pressure Test: Conduct a pressure test to determine the exact pressure levels. This will help you identify if the problem is with the pump or the entire system.
Pump Evaluation: If the pump is suspected to be the issue, remove it and inspect it for internal damage. Look for signs of wear, such as scoring or pitting on the surfaces.
Replacement or Repair: Depending on the extent of the damage, you may opt for a complete pump replacement or attempt to repair it by replacing worn-out parts.
Preventive Measures: Once the issue is resolved, take steps to prevent future occurrences. Regular maintenance, such as oil changes and filter replacements, is crucial.
